AI Government Experts Unveil Strategies to Enhance Public Services with Automation and ML

AI government experts reveal strategies that leverage machine learning and data analytics to enhance public services, boost efficiency, and improve citizen engagement across agencies like NASA and the U.S. Department of Energy.

Prominent AI government keynote speakers are exploring how artificial intelligence is reshaping public administration, policy implementation, and citizen engagement. These discussions, which include talks, breakout sessions, and training workshops, provide officials, policymakers, and public sector leaders with insights into leveraging automation, machine learning (ML), and large language models (LLMs) to improve efficiency, transparency, and decision-making in a digital and data-driven world.

Data analytics is emerging as a crucial tool for public services. Machine learning algorithms are being employed to sift through vast datasets from healthcare, transportation, social services, and public safety. They identify patterns, predict needs, and optimize service delivery. Notably, AI government experts assert that these technologies allow for proactive resource allocation, reduced inefficiencies, and enhanced community service. Agencies such as NASA and the U.S. Department of Energy exemplify public institutions effectively using AI to boost operational efficiency and inform policy planning.

Another significant area of focus is predictive governance and policy modeling. AI government leaders emphasize the importance of smart tools that simulate the impact of policy changes, forecast economic or social outcomes, and support data-driven decision-making. By anticipating challenges, these tools enable governments to prioritize interventions and implement policies that yield measurable results.

Citizen engagement and digital services have also become central themes in this discourse. Innovative technologies like smart chatbots, virtual assistants, and automated communication platforms are designed to streamline citizen inquiries and facilitate access to government services. By analyzing feedback and sentiment, these AI-driven systems help officials better understand public needs and work towards improving trust in political institutions.

As discussions progress, cybersecurity and infrastructure resilience remain critical topics. Experts emphasize the role of technology and IT solutions in monitoring critical infrastructure, detecting potential threats, and supporting rapid responses to emergencies. Such measures are essential for maintaining the continuity of vital public services.

Furthermore, the conversation around ethics, fairness, and regulatory compliance is gaining momentum. Professionals in the field stress the importance of responsible AI deployment, particularly regarding the protection of citizen data, ensuring algorithmic fairness, and adhering to privacy and governance standards.

The evolving public sector workforce is another aspect being highlighted by AI government keynote speakers. As technology augments human roles, public sector employees are being liberated from repetitive data processing and operational tasks. This shift enables them to concentrate on strategic decision-making, policy analysis, and high-value civic engagement, essential functions in an AI-driven landscape.

As public sector leaders seek to harness AI responsibly, the potential for enhancing public services and navigating the rapidly changing technological landscape becomes evident. By leveraging these advanced tools effectively, governments can not only improve operational efficiencies but also foster a more engaged and informed citizenry, underscoring the broader significance of these discussions for the future of governance.
